Red wall paint colors come in a variety of shades, and choosing the right one for your living room can be a daunting task. When selecting a red paint color, consider the size and lighting of your living room. If your living room is small, opt for lighter shades of red, such as coral or salmon. These shades will make the room feel more spacious and airy. For larger living rooms, you can go for darker and bolder shades of red, like maroon or brick red. With so many shades of red to choose from, it can be challenging to determine which one is the best for your living room walls. But some popular red paint options include Behr's Red Pepper, Sherwin Williams' Fireworks, and Benjamin Moore's Caliente. These shades have been tried and tested and are known for their rich and vibrant hues. You can also opt for custom-mixed shades to get the exact red color you desire. As mentioned earlier, there are various shades of red that you can choose from for your living room walls. Some popular options include scarlet red, vermilion, and garnet. These shades have different undertones, so it's essential to consider the other colors in your living room to ensure they complement each other. Lastly, it's essential to consider the finish of your red wall paint. A glossy finish will reflect light and make the color look more vibrant, while a matte finish will give a more subtle and muted look. Ultimately, the finish will depend on your personal preference and the overall aesthetic of your living room.
